Hussein Ali Hussein (right), the Habbaniyah district mayor, Ali Dawood (center), the chairman of the Habbaniyah City Council and Kevin Anderson (left), a representative from the Embedded Provincial Reconstruction Team - Ramadi, cut the ceremonious ribbon at the Habbaniyah government center's grand opening, Oct. 25, 2008. The government center has been four months in the making and is now complete, standing as a symbol of a representative government taking hold in the area.
